Transaction 2e3b86c9d767dc6cfdb14b4c0b4344985c18f01c0c4c4440ecce475513c12a79
1 Input
2 Outputs
- 2e3b86c9d767dc6cfdb14b4c0b4344985c18f01c0c4c4440ecce475513c12a79:0
- 2e3b86c9d767dc6cfdb14b4c0b4344985c18f01c0c4c4440ecce475513c12a79:1
value 21123728
address 3JcNeC8EZ7nswcfgfMqXhdFgyyTkjM4hwK
value 878524
address 3JrtrD7TWJJusQrcaRAkViziQ5PQpVoxM9